Output 26b6cb57cd039fd4524e6b566ce559fb1d4625198c2a72240140fa964e84002a:28

value
46897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f78e14f52c704807d589e70043ddbb1fc19d88e OP_EQUAL
address
3EmdMsbsA28cF1Z6CrUzkyspEMLkyVacvP
transaction
26b6cb57cd039fd4524e6b566ce559fb1d4625198c2a72240140fa964e84002a
spent
true